Why are non-transactable items allowed to be pick released when ship set is enforced?
(Doc ID 1348697.1)
Last updated on JUNE 23, 2023
Applies to:
Oracle Shipping Execution - Version 11.5.10.2 and laterInformation in this document applies to any platform.
Goal
Scenario:
You have 10 order lines.
- 8 lines have items which are shippable / stockable in inventory
- The other 2 order lines have items are not stockable and not shippable
- All order lines are on the same ship set.
- Ship Sets and Ship Model complete is enforced.
Why does the system allow the order lines with the non-transactable / non-stockable items to be pick released; when one of the shippable lines has insufficient quantity on hand?
